1. Biography of Shannon Sharpe

Shannon Sharpe is a former professional American football player turned sports analyst. He played as a tight end in the National Football League (NFL) for the Denver Broncos and the Baltimore Ravens. Born on June 26, 1968, in Chicago, Illinois, he had a successful college career at Savannah State University.

Sharpe was inducted into the Pro Football Hall of Fame in 2011, recognizing his outstanding contributions to the sport. Following his retirement, he transitioned into broadcasting, where he gained fame for his candid opinions and engaging presence on television.

2. Overview of Shannon Sharpe's Contract

Shannon Sharpe's contract with ESPN has been a focal point in discussions about sports media salaries. When he joined ESPN in 2016, his deal was reported to be valued at around $1.5 million annually. This figure has reportedly increased as his popularity and demand have grown over the years.

His role in "Undisputed" has not only made him a household name but has also allowed him to leverage his platform for additional income through endorsements and appearances. The structure of his contract reflects the increasing financial stakes in sports broadcasting, particularly as streaming platforms and social media continue to reshape the landscape.
